Competition entries categories
  • Neuroposters

    Create static visual compositions using neural networks with the artificial intelligence employed to generate or process images. Posters shall engage in communication within a single powerful visual composition, combining text items and graphic elements.


    Entries specifications:

    • Mandatory use of neural networks for generating or processing visual elements
    • Provided in JPG format (highest quality, no lower than 10 out of 12)
    • Resolution: at least 300 dpi (for high-quality printing)
    • Composition format: A3 (297 x 420 mm)
    • From one Competitioner or a team of contributors: no more than three entries (except for series)
  • Neurovideos

    Create dynamic videos using neural networks with the artificial intelligence employed for creative production, editing, and storytelling. Videos shall be dynamic and engaging, with a fast-moving storyline and a vivid protagonist. Remember: the first 3 seconds are crucial—start with vivid not-to-be-missed images.


    Entries specifications:

    • Mandatory use of neural networks for generating or processing videos
    • Format: MP4 (h264 and aac codecs)
    • Format proportions: 9:16 (portrait format)
    • Video size: from 720 × 1280 px up to 1080 × 1920 px
    • Resolution: Full HD and above
    • Video length: 5–30 seconds
    • Frame rate: 60 FPS
    • Maximum size: 1 GB

    From one Competitioner or a team of contributors: no more than three entries

Evaluation criteria to be applied by the jury
The professional jury will evaluate the entries based on the criteria that follow:
  • Creativity and originality of the idea

    How unconventional and unexpected your approach to tackling the topic is
  • Harmony between design and color
    Visual perfection of the work
  • Visual consistency with the stated final prompt
    Accuracy of the concept implementation
  • Visual consistency with real objects
    Authenticity and credibility
